Population & Demographics

The following information lists the population statistics and breakdown for the 98813 zip code. The total population is 2642, of which, 1291 are male and 1351 are female. With a total area of 304.946 square miles, the population density is 9.3 people per square mile. The median age of the population is 28 years old. Income & Economic Characteristics

The median inflation-adjusted family income in the 98813 zip code is $51094. This is -23.37% less than the national average. This income places 19.4% of the population below the poverty line. The average retirement income for individuals in this zip code (for those that have it) is $32479. Education

In the 98813 zip code, 40.1% of individuals over 25 years old have a high school degree or higher, and 3.8% have a bachelors degree or higher. Additionally, 5.5% of individuals 3 years and older are in private school, and 94.5% are in public school. The data below outline the education level breakdown, degree field breakdown, and more.




Occupation and Work Characteristics

In the 98813 zip, there are an estimated 1292 people in the labor force, of which, 1218 are employed, and 74 are unemployed. There are a total of 0 people in the armed forces. The average commute time for this zip code is 26.3 minutes. Of the total people that work, 19 worked from home and 1193 commuted. The average number of hours worked is 40.7. Housing

The median home value for the 98813 zip code is 139700. There is an estimated  807 number of occupied housing units, the median gross rent in is $759 per month, and the average monthly housing costs are estimated to be $629.
